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,363 in Kolbotn versus $1,017 in Medellin.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,735 in Kolbotn versus $1,602 in Medellin.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$5,106 in Kolbotn versus $2,188 in Medellin.

Living in Kolbotn is roughly 132% more expensive than Medellin, driven mainly by Eating Out.

The two cities straddle the global median: Kolbotn is 76% above, Medellin is 24% below.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,197 in Kolbotn and $482 in Medellin.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Dining out: $99.0 in Kolbotn vs $33.00 in Medellin for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$460 vs $190 per month, with Medellin cheaper across the board.
